Model: LNZDS1030S2+SBT80 The dry mortar mixing plantt is a specialized facility designed to produce ready-to-use construction mortars by blending cement, sand, additives, and polymers in precise proportions. Equipped with advanced mortar mixers, the Ready Mix Mortar Plant ensures consistent quality and high efficiency. It is widely used for manufacturing masonry mortar, plastering mortar, tile adhesives, self-leveling compounds, and other specialty mortars.

Key Features

1.High Mixing Precision

A dry mortar mixing plant is equipped with advanced mixers that ensure uniform blending of cement, sand, additives, and polymers. The even distribution guarantees consistent quality across all mortar types.

2. Automated Weighing & Control System

The Ready Mix Mortar Plant uses automated systems for accurate weighing, batching, and recipe management. PLC and HMI interfaces allow for easy operation, real-time monitoring, and error alerts.

3. Flexible Production Capabilities

Whether for masonry mortar, plastering mortar, tile adhesive, or specialty blends, the dry mix concrete batching plant can be customized to produce multiple formulations with fast changeover and minimal residue.

4. Eco-Friendly & Dust-Free Operation

The dry mortar mixing plant is equipped with dust collection systems, enclosed conveyors, and sealed mixing chambers, ensuring clean and safe production environments.

5. Integrated Packaging & Storage

A Ready Mix Mortar Plant often includes valve bag packers, jumbo bag stations, and automatic palletizers. This streamlines logistics and enhances overall efficiency.

6. Scalable & Modular Design

The dry mix concrete batching plant can be expanded as demand grows. Its modular layout allows for quick installation and future upgrades without major structural changes.

7. High Production Efficiency

With continuous feeding and fast discharge mechanisms, the Ready Mix Mortar Plant delivers high output with minimal downtime, ideal for large-scale commercial use.

1.Masonry Mortar Production

The dry mortar mixing plant is widely used for producing high-quality masonry mortar, ideal for bricklaying, blockwork, and stone masonry in residential and commercial buildings.

2.Plastering Mortar for Interior & Exterior Walls
A Ready Mix Mortar Plant efficiently produces smooth, consistent plastering mortar, improving wall finishing and surface quality for both internal and external applications.

3.Tile Adhesives & Grouts
The dry mix concrete batching plant can be configured to produce strong bonding tile adhesives and flexible grouts, suitable for various substrate conditions and tiling systems.

4.Self-Leveling Floor Compounds
A dry mortar mixing plant is used to manufacture self-leveling floor mortars, widely applied in commercial, industrial, and office flooring for smooth and even surfaces.

5.Thermal Insulation & Anti-Crack Mortars
The Ready Mix Mortar Plant produces specialized insulation and anti-crack mortars used in external thermal insulation systems (ETICS), enhancing energy efficiency in modern buildings.

6.Repair & Structural Mortars
With its flexibility, the dry mix concrete batching plant can create repair mortars for concrete restoration, bridge maintenance, and structural reinforcements.

7.Decorative and Colored Mortars
A dry mortar mixing plant can also handle the production of decorative or pigmented mortars for architectural finishes.

  • How to Choose the Most Suitable Equipment?

    First, customers should provide information on the type and hardness of local raw materials (e.g., granite, river pebbles, limestone etc.). Next, customers need to specify the desired finished product requirements, including fineness modulus and particle shape. Then, based on the required production capacity (e.g., tons per hour), different models can be recommended—for example, a shaping sand making machine for higher output, or equipment tailored for ordinary or specialized mortar production depending on the application. Finally, customers can select and customize the equipment based on site conditions, installation environment, energy consumption, maintenance costs, and overall project budget.
